        static void Main(string[] args)
        {
            CallableRunrepSession runrep = null;
            CallableLoaderSession loader = null;

            try
            {
                // Start the runrep session using our login info. Don't use a shared connection.
                runrep = new CallableRunrepSession(GENEVA_SOAP_URL, GENEVA_HOST_NAME, GENEVA_PORT, GENEVA_USERNAME, GENEVA_PASSWORD, false);

                // Run a simple Geneva SQL SELECT statement and print the results to the command line. Use a shared connection.
                runrep.RunSQLSelect("NameSort, NameLine1 from Exchange", CallableRunrepSession.RunrepResultTypes.DataStructure);

                // Run the select statement, but get the results back in object XML format.
                runrep.RunSQLSelect("NameSort, NameLine1 from Exchange", CallableRunrepSession.RunrepResultTypes.Literal);

                // Run the select statement, but get the results back in string XML format.
                runrep.RunSQLSelect("NameSort, NameLine1 from Exchange", CallableRunrepSession.RunrepResultTypes.String);

                // Run a report, and pass in the parameters. Literal results is an object that can be serialized to XML or the Console.
                runrep.RunReport("tranhist.rsl", "-p qacash", CallableRunrepSession.RunrepResultTypes.Literal);

                // Run a report, and pass in the parameters. Returns the results in String format that can be loaded into an XmlDocument.
                runrep.RunReport("tranhist.rsl", "-p qacash", CallableRunrepSession.RunrepResultTypes.String);

                // Run a formatted csv report, and pass in the parameters. Returns the name of a file that is
                // then streamed back locally and saved to a local file.
                runrep.RunReport("tranhist.rsl", "-p qacash", CallableRunrepSession.RunrepResultTypes.FormattedCSV);

                // Run a formatted pdf report, and pass in the parameters. Returns the name of a file that is
                // then streamed back locally and saved to a local file.
                runrep.RunReport("tranhist.rsl", "-p qacash", CallableRunrepSession.RunrepResultTypes.FormattedPDF);
            }
            catch (Exception e)
            {
                Console.WriteLine("Error running report request.");
                Console.WriteLine(e);
            }
            finally
            {
                //If this is not a shared connection, shut it down.
                if (runrep != null)
                    runrep.ShutdownSession();
            }

            try
            {
                // Create the loader session using our login info.
                loader = new CallableLoaderSession(GENEVA_SOAP_URL, GENEVA_HOST_NAME, GENEVA_PORT, GENEVA_USERNAME, GENEVA_PASSWORD, false);

                // Load some simple XML, one successful record, one with an error.
                loader.LoadData(SAMPLE_LOADER_XML);
            }
            catch (Exception e)
            {
                Console.WriteLine("Error running data load.");
                Console.WriteLine(e);
            }
            finally
            {
                // If this is not a shared connection, we need to shut it down.
                if (loader != null)
                    loader.ShutdownSession();
            }
        }
